In this episode, Nolan Gray and Ned Resnikoff chat with Danielle Allen. Allen is a professor of political philosophy, ethics, and public policy at Harvard University, and director of the Allen Lab for Democracy Renovation. She is also the author of the recent book, Justice By Means of Democracy.
In this episode, they discuss power-sharing liberalism, abundance progressivism, and what it all means for the future of metropolitan governance.
